MCP6L71T-E/OT Overview
The packing method for this particular product is known as tape and reel, which is a popular method used in the electronics industry for packaging integrated circuits. The technology used in this product is CMOS, which stands for Complementary Metal-Oxide-Semiconductor. This technology allows for low power consumption and high-speed performance. The peak reflow temperature for this product is 260 degrees Celsius, while the maximum reflow time is 40 seconds. With one circuit and a nominal supply current of 150μA, this product is designed to operate efficiently with an output current of 25mA. The voltage supply for this product is between 2V and 6V, making it suitable for both single and dual power supplies. Additionally, the voltage input offset is only 1mV, ensuring high accuracy and stability. This product is also designed with no low-offset, providing reliable and consistent performance.
